【24h】

Optimized coverage-directed random simulation

机译:优化的覆盖 - 定向随机模拟

获取原文

摘要

Due to the growing complexity of modern digital systems, functional verification is still an important challenge. Current verification practice in industry and in academia includes simulation and formal techniques. While formal tools can handle small to medium size designs, only simulation-based tools can validate digital systems of almost infinite complexity. One of the main disadvantages of simulation is that only one set of behaviors is explored. In order to improve simulation, several coverage metrics have been proposed. These metrics (such as line, path or conditional coverage) provide information about the variety of behavior that a particular test-bench explores. With modern digital systems, it is difficult to obtain high coverage, thus a key challenge, according to the latest report of the ITRS, is to create new solutions that can provide high coverage at all hierarchical levels of a design. Verification plans commonly use random test bench generation. However, this technique normally provides a low coverage that is not improved by increasing the number of test-benches. The main contribution of this paper is the development of a behavioral verification technique that enables the improvement of the coverage of random test-benches. The algorithm takes advantage of the structure of the behavioral system description and the information that the simulation produces.
机译:由于现代数字系统的复杂性日益增长,功能验证仍然是一个重要的挑战。工业和学术界的当前验证实践包括模拟和正式技术。虽然正式工具可以处理中小型设计,但只有基于仿真的工具可以验证几乎无限复杂的数字系统。模拟的主要缺点之一是探索一组行为。为了改善模拟,已经提出了几个覆盖度量。这些指标(例如线路,路径或条件覆盖范围)提供了有关特定测试台探索的各种行为的信息。利用现代数字系统,难以获得高覆盖范围,从而符合ITRS的最新报告的关键挑战,是创建新的解决方案,可以在设计的所有分层级别提供高覆盖率。验证计划通常使用随机测试台生成。然而,该技术通常通过增加测试台的数量来提供不改善的低覆盖范围。本文的主要贡献是开发行为验证技术,可以改善随机测试台的覆盖范围。该算法利用了行为系统描述的结构和模拟产生的信息。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号